On Friday afternoon Donabate’s senior ladies hockey team took to the pitch against Mt. Anville in the Leinster Quarter Final. The teams were evenly matched and both had opportunities to score however it was 0-0 at the end of full time and the game went to penalty strokes. Unfortunately, Donabate lost out 4-1 in flicks. The girls are disappointed to miss out on a spot in the semi-final but as usual they are a credit to our school and were very gracious in defeat.
We are very proud of their efforts this year in what was a strong league.

Lady of the match goes to Isobel O’Dea and Erin McGahan. Isobel had a solid performance in defence despite being under a lot of pressure at times. Meanwhile, Erin pulled off some fantastic saves in the first half to keep us in the game and has had a wonderful season in goal.
